Central Slovakia is a region in Ukraine and its capital is Zilina. Its original owner is Slovakia.
History
The region has changed hands many times due to war. It was made a part of the Czech Republic as a result of the Slovakia-Czech Republic War. Then it became part of Hungary after the Hungary-Czech Republic War. Central Slovakia became part of Romania as a result of World War I. Central Slovakia then became part of Slovakia again due to Slovak Independence War in this region.
